#d5cea4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5cea4 is composed of 83.5% red, 80.8%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 23%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 51.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.8% and a lightness of 73.9%. #d5cea4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ab9d49.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#d5cea4 color description : Grayish yellow.
#d5cea4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5cea4 has RGB values of R:213, G:206,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.23,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14012068.
